What companies run services between Spring Hill, Hernando County, FL, USA and Charleston, SC, USA?

There is no direct connection from Spring Hill to Charleston. However, you can take the taxi to Brooksville Wawa, take the shuttle to Tampa International Airport - Red Terminal, walk to Tampa (TPA) airport, fly to Charleston International Airport (CHS), walk to Charleston International Airport, then take the line 11 bus to Transit Mall.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Spring Hill to Charleston via Tampa Bus Station, Marion Transit Center, Nebraska Av @ Twiggs St, Tampa, Kissimmee Amtrak Station, and Charleston Amtrak Station in around 14h 2m.
